Output 6c0409591f20a0cf4aefa91c3b66e2f049d3e79f4af4f92d9d15d372ba342791:63

value
652113
script pubkey
OP_0 OP_PUSHBYTES_20 31b7efdc275b995c60ac6d1e67f4c3d7fb25569a
address
bc1qxxm7lhp8twv4cc9vd50x0axr6laj2456llylmr
transaction
6c0409591f20a0cf4aefa91c3b66e2f049d3e79f4af4f92d9d15d372ba342791
spent
true